Cuando el alqueno (A) reacciona con agua, se obtiene un alcohol (B). Por oxidación del mismo en condiciones moderadas, se forma 2 metil propanal. Si este aldehído se oxida enérgicamente, obtendremos el ácido carboxílico (C), que al reaccionar con etanol forma el éster (D). A partir del ácido carboxílico (C), también podemos obtener una amida (E) usando amoníaco.
A su vez, si dos moléculas de este ácido sufren una reacción de condensación, dan un anhídrido.

Escribir las reacciones correspondientes y nombrar los compuestos que se obtienen.
